About this plugin
The DSH ecosystem is not short on pets: two dozen-plus desk toys mirror agent state, and dsh-digipet added deep raising of a single pet that grows with your work output. What was missing, though, was the full collection loop—encounter, throw, dex, team. dsh-wildmon bolts that loop onto your real turns, inbox messages, tool calls, and error events, so writing code stirs the forging-knack grass, reading and research spooks the ink-forest, and a string of stack traces is just the fault-ridge telling you a rare is about to poke its head out.
Five biomes map to how you work: file writes and shell commands draw you to the forging-knack, code reading and research to the ink-forest, tool failures and agent errors to the fault-ridge, and anything after midnight into the night threshold. The 28-slot dex spans four rarity tiers with a 1/64 shiny chance, and three legendaries hide behind specific conditions—every 250 turns, late-night error sounds, or a near-complete dex. The ball economy is self-sustaining: start with 8, gain 1 per completed turn, and get 2 back for duplicate catches, so chasing a rare never bankrupts your stash. Crucially, the plugin adds zero tokens to any model request: no tool registration, no session injection, no reading of your code, no KV-cache impact. Every listener sits inside a try/catch, so the grass can collapse without touching your build.
It is built for developers who live inside DSH, love collection-style games, and want the next error to feel like a spawn point rather than a ticket. It complements dsh-digipet rather than replacing it—one offers deep raising of a single pet, the other broad collecting of a whole menagerie—and the two coexist cleanly with separate commands, separate save files, and no collision.
